Deadline: 4-Sep-22
Applications are now open for the Youth Climate Innovation Lab, a fast-paced three-day event during which youth innovators from across the MENA region, with the support of climate technology, entrepreneurship, and business experts, will explore design thinking tools to ideate and validate innovative solutions for climate mitigation and adaptation within selected sectors and technology fields.
The program will help participants flex their entrepreneurial muscles and by the end create business solutions for enhanced climate action in response to climate change threats to the MENA region.
Supported by private sector experts, entrepreneurs, and innovation facilitators, the participants will be challenged to think outside of the box and co-create timely solutions and business ideas to address pressing challenges in climate change. This program will provide a hands-on learning space in which participants explore and implement frameworks for ideation and validation to solve common and critical problems in innovative, viable, and sustainable ways.
Funding Information
- At the end of the Climate Innovation Lab, the winners from the MENA region will be participate in the 6-8 week Climate Innovation Academy Program delivered by Seedstars and receive follow-on support to implement and scale their solutions.
- The top 3 teams will receive a prize of 1,860 USD and the chance to attend the United Nations Climate Change conference (COP27) in November in Egypt.
Eligibility Criteria
People can apply either as a team (a minimum of 2 members) or as individuals (who they will group into teams).
- For Startup Teams:
- Already formed team of at least 2 members who are tacking or looking to explore ideas in Climate change mitigation innovation and technologies. The criteria listed below for Individuals apply to the members of the team.
- Startups at idea or prototyping stage are welcome to apply.
- For individuals
- Anyone who is:
- Between 20 and 30 years old
- Attending university or has completed higher education
- An aspiring or early-stage entrepreneur or student interested in building entrepreneurial muscle and launching an idea to address climate change
- Passionate about solving climate technology needs and challenges in the MENA, especially those listed in the focus challenges
